About

Stefano Bonaccorsi is a scholar working on Finance, Control and Systems Engineering and Mathematical Physics. According to data from OpenAlex, Stefano Bonaccorsi has authored 46 papers receiving a total of 286 ind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Finance, 20 papers in Control and Systems Engineering and 18 papers in Mathematical Physics. Recurrent topics in Stefano Bonaccorsi's work include Stochastic processes and financial applications (27 papers), Stability and Controllability of Differential Equations (20 papers) and Advanced Mathematical Modeling in Engineering (17 papers). Stefano Bonaccorsi is often cited by papers focused on Stochastic processes and financial applications (27 papers), Stability and Controllability of Differential Equations (20 papers) and Advanced Mathematical Modeling in Engineering (17 papers). Stefano Bonaccorsi collaborates with scholars based in Italy, Romania and Germany. Stefano Bonaccorsi's co-authors include Luciano Tubaro, Giuseppina Guatteri, Piet Van Mieghem, Francesco De Pellegrini, Viorel Barbu, Sonia Mazzucchi, Elisa Alòs, Wolfgang Desch, Giuseppe Da Prato and Annalisa Socievole and has published in prestigious journals such as Journal of Mathematical Analysis and Applications, Journal of Differential Equations and SIAM Journal on Control and Optimization.
